Tour guides/receptionists wear transmitters to provide commentary, while tourists wear receivers to listen. The sound quality is clear and it is widely used in various scenarios such as tourism, factory visits, conferences, training, and education.
The two-way communication guided tour system allows participants to communicate and interact with the guide in real time. It is suitable for factory visits, equestrian training, tourism, training, conferences, etc., and enhances the visit and learning experience.
Full-duplex tour guide systems allow two or more guides to flexibly take turns providing commentary, maintain real-time communication, and improve collaboration efficiency.Tourists listen through receivers. These systems are widely used in tourism, factory visits, conferences, training sessions, and other scenarios.
The audio guide device supports self-guided tours for visitors, eliminating the need for a tour guide. Visitors can trigger the audio playback by entering the code corresponding to a specific exhibit or attraction on the audio guide keyboard.
The tour guide receiver is a device carried by tourists or participants to receive the audio signal transmitted by the tour guide transmitter. It enables users to clearly hear the tour guide or speaker's explanation even in noisy environments or large venues.
